what would be the answer if the heuristic value of I=0 and G=9 and Is it compulsory that goal state must have least value
@rickroll4578
4 жыл бұрын
I guess then we have to backtrack...not sure though
@olenshofiti3208
4 жыл бұрын
The greedy best-first algorithm is incomplete which means that it might NOT find the solution. It does not backtrack. If G was 9 and I was 0 the algorithm would go in an infinite loop. It would go back and forth to F and I.

How did u decide the heuristic value for each of the node? Like y u took h (n) for node S =13 only? Y not 5 or any random value?
@Dubspez
3 жыл бұрын
Think of h() as a function and n is your input. h() could be any function you can think of with certain rules or conditions. When you input n in h() or h(n) you generate a heuristic value. n would probably be a value directly related to the node you're computing the heuristic value for. You use said heuristic value to make comparisons for best-first search. Does that explain it?
